Sodium salicylate is a salt form of salicylic acid, a compound derived from willow bark and wintergreen plants. It's used in cosmetics to help preserve products and prevent the growth of unwanted bacteria and microorganisms.
This ingredient acts as a preservative to extend the shelf life of cosmetic products and prevent microbial contamination, while also serving as a denaturant to make products unsuitable for ingestion.
